Motor alterations are reduced in mice lacking the PARK2 gene in the presence of a human FTDP-17 mutant form of four-repeat tau.
Journal of the neurological sciences - 15 Dec 2008
Navarro P, Guerrero R, Gallego E, Avila J, Luquin R, Garcia Ruiz P J, Sanchez M P
Abstract excerpt
Independent deletion of the PARK2 gene and hTauVLW over-expression in mice produce mild alterations in the brain. However, the presence of both mutations in a parkin-deficient and hTauVLW double mutant mouse causes a tau neuropathology, reactive astrocytosis, and neuronal loss in the cortex and hippocampus, as well as lesions in nigrostriatal and motor neurons.
